  • Converting a Standard InfoCube to a Real-Time InfoCube while Maintaining Data

    There could be a couple of reasons why you might wish to convert your Standard InfoCube to a Real-Time InfoCube:

    - your user's needs may change and you require the data to be kept closer to real-time, or

    - the amount of data you are loading increases and you're finding the InfoCube's write performance is simply too slow.

    The Real-Time InfoCube supports parallel write access making it much faster compared to the Standard InfoCube. This can be combined with a daemon service that is scheduled to check the InfoSource for any changes, if found the delta is quickly updated.

    How to convert:

    1. Go to the ABAP Editor (SE80) and select Edit Object

    2. Execute the program 'sap_convert_normal_trans'

    3. Enter the InfoCube's name and decide the direction of the conversion.

    Once the InfoCube has been converted it will be ready and any data you previously had in the InfoCube will remain intact.
